2. What Are Cookies

Cookies are small text files that are stored on your computer or mobile device when you visit a website. They are widely used to make websites work more efficiently and provide information to the website owners.

Cookies allow a website to recognize your device and remember if you've been to the website before. They can be used to store your preferences, remember your settings, analyze how you use the website, and help with security.
